Understanding Research Peptide Purity and Analysis

Assessing a peptide’s purity is fundamentally important for reliable research findings. Evaluating peptide purity often requires several analytical techniques , including High-Performance Liquid Chromatography (HPLC) coupled with Mass Spectrometry (MS) and Amino Acid AA. These assessments give insights regarding the presence of impurities and assist researchers to confirm the identity and correctness of the synthesized compound .

Managing Research Chains Secure Precautions

Careful management of research fragments necessitates strict safety guidelines due to their potential active activity. Regularly don appropriate individual gear , like gloves , ocular shields, and research gowns . Prevent dermal contact and breathing in by conducting procedures within a fume enclosure . Peptide mixtures should be handled as possibly dangerous materials , requiring designated elimination protocols . Consult the material safety information document (MSDS/SDS) for precise information regarding the specific peptide being employed .
